@charset "utf-8";
/* CSS Document */
body{  margin:0 0 0 0; font-family:Arial; font-family: 'Poppins'; }
*{ margin:0; padding:0px; list-style-type:none;}
li{ list-style-type:none;}
img{ border:0px;vertical-align: middle;}
.clear{ clear:both;}

h1,h2,h3{font-family:Calibri; font-weight:normal;}
a:link {text-decoration: none;}
a:visited {text-decoration: none;}
a:hover {text-decoration: none;}
a:active {text-decoration: none;}
input {outline:none;}
 input::-webkit-input-placeholder {
       /* placeholder颜色  */
        color: #888;
        /* placeholder字体大小  */
        font-size: 16px;
       /* placeholder位置  */
  
    } 
textarea::-webkit-input-placeholder {
       /* placeholder颜色  */
        color: #333;
        /* placeholder字体大小  */
        font-size: 16px;
       /* placeholder位置  */
  
    }

@font-face {
  font-family: 'century';
  src:url('century.ttf') format('truetype');
}

/* CSS Document */
@font-face {
/* font-test*/
font-family: temil;
src:url('tamil/TamilMN.svg'),
url('tamil/TamilMN.ttf'),
url('tamil/TamilMN.eot'); /* IE9 */
}

@font-face {
/* font-test*/
font-family: Roboto Thin;
src:url('Roboto Thin.ttf'); /* IE9 */
}
@font-face {
/* font-test*/
font-family: cczt;
src:url('Roboto-Bold.ttf'); /* IE9 */
}
@font-face {
  font-family: 'Poppins';
  src:url('Poppins/Poppins.ttf') format('truetype');
}
@font-face {
  font-family: 'Poppins-SemiBold';
  src:url('Poppins/Poppins-SemiBold.ttf') format('truetype');
}

/*公用css*/
.ce2{ box-shadow: -2px 0px 3px 1px rgba(0, 0, 0, 0.12);
    shadow-distance: 2px; }
.dqwz_ma{background:#f1f1f1;}
.ce2 .logoa{display:none;}
.ce2 .logob{display:block;}
.ce2 .search_bg button{color:#fff;}
.ce2 .fkm_headdh{position:fixed; z-index: 888;}
.cp_wz img{width:100%;}
.qm_maina,.qm_mainc,.wh_syjjla,.wh_syjjlb,.wh_syjjlc,.wh_syjjrb,.wh_syjjld,.wh_title,.wh_synewsla,.wh_synewslb,.wh_whtxtb,.wh_whtxtca,.wh_whtxtcb,.das_fend,.qywh_lista,.qywh_listb,.wh_syjjle,.unti_lb,.wh_case,.wh_casea1,.wh_casea2,.das_newsb,.wh_join,.wh_joina,.wh_joinb,.wh_joinc,.wh_video,#page,.mor_a,.cp_syss,.xkh_title,.skh_tjnewsa,.skh_tjnewsb,.skh_xpemail,#kws_search,.xkh_cplefta,.xkh_cplefta1,.xkh_cplefta2,.xkh_cplefta3,.xkh_cplista,.xkh_cplistb,.cp_right,.cp_xqab,.cp_xqaa,.zxly_menub,.zxly_menuc,.zxly_menud,.cs_main,.fkm_headdh,.ff_syunti,.ff_syuntia1,.ff_syuntia2,.ff_video,.ff_syimglist,.swiper-paginationimg,.hzhb_ap{width:100%; float: left;}
#kws_search{display:none;}
.wh_syjjld a{float:left;}
.wh_synewsla{position:relative;}
.wh_synewsra{float: left;border: 1px solid #eee; }
.wh_synewsla span{position:absolute; left: 0px; bottom:0px; padding: 15px;color:#fff; background-color:rgba(6,51,107,0.7);}
.wh_syjjrba{position: absolute; background: #1f3362; text-align: center;transform: rotate(-90deg);-o-transform: rotate(-90deg);-webkit-transform: rotate(-90deg);-moz-transform: rotate(-90deg); }
.wh_syjjrb{width:100%; background: #152751; position: relative; color:#fff; }
.wh_syjjra span{width:100%; height: 100%; text-align: center; top:0px; left: 0px; line-height: 100%; font-size:70px;color:rgba(255,255,255,0.6); padding-top: 25%; cursor: pointer;}
.wh_servera span{padding:15px; background: #fff; color:#222; border-radius: 500px;}
.wh_syjjld a:link,.wh_syjjld a:visited{color:#fff;}
.wh_server a:link,.wh_server a:visited{color:#fff;}
.wh_servera{position:absolute; text-align: center;width: 100%; height: 100%; top:0px; background-color:rgba(6,51,107,0.7);}
.wh_servera a:link,.wh_servera a:visited{color:#fff;}
.wh_server:hover .wh_servera{display: block;animation: hideIndex 0.3s;  -moz-animation: hideIndex  0.3s; -webkit-animation: hideIndex  0.3s;  -o-animation: hideIndex  0.3s;}
.wh_server{background:#222; position: relative;}
.wh_syjjld a{background: #222; }
.wh_syjjlc dd span{float:left; color:#f60; }
.wh_syjjra{position:relative;}
.wh_syjjra span{position:absolute;}
.head_rtfh li{float:left; position: relative; }
.fkm_headdh li{float:left;}
.fkm_headdh li a:link,.fkm_headdh li a:visited{color:#fff;}
.fkm_headdh li:hover .hover_a{font-weight:bold;}
.fkm_headlogo img{width:100%;}
.lm_ycdh{position:absolute; display: none;transition: all 0.6s;}
.ce2 .fkm_headdh li a:link,.ce2 .fkm_headdh li a:visited{color:#fff;}

.lm_ycdha{margin-top:-13px;}
.fkm_headdh li:hover a{color:#036eb8;}
.lm_ycdha span{transform: rotate(-90deg);-o-transform: rotate(-90deg);-webkit-transform: rotate(-90deg);
-moz-transform: rotate(-90deg); display: block; width: 40px; color:#c30404;height: 40px; margin-left: 30px;}
.lm_ycdhb{margin-top:-4px;}
.lm_ycdhb dd:hover{padding:3px 18px;}
.head_rtfh li button{border:0px; background: none; color:#fff;}
.wh_bga{background:url(../images/bg_about.jpg) ; position: relative;}
.wh_syjjla{color:#fff;}
.wh_bgb{ background: url(../images/bg2.jpg) center fixed; padding: 3% 0px; color:#fff;}
.wh_bgc{background:#f1f1f1; position: relative;}
.wh_synewsra dd{color:#1b3053; font-size:16px;}
.wh_synewsra{position:relative;}
.wh_synewsra span{position:absolute; width: 50px; height: 3px; background:#1b3053;}
.wh_synewsra a:link,.wh_synewsra a:visited{color:#1b3053;}
	.wh_bgd{position:relative;}
	.whwh_b{background:#fe5603;}
	.whwh_a{background: #152751;}
.wh_whtxtb2 span{position:absolute; border-radius: 500px;}
.wh_whtxtcb li input,.wh_whtxtcb textarea{width:100%; border: 1px solid #eee; padding: 15px 20px; }
	.wh_whtxtcb textarea{height:140px;}
	.wh_whtxtcb button{border: 0px; padding:12px 30px; background: #fe5603; color:#fff; font-size:18px; margin-top: 30px;}
	.wh_bge{background:#f1f1f1; padding: 5% 0px;}

.hzhb_wh h1{position:absolute;color:#fff;  text-align: center; width: 100%; left: 0px; height: 100%; top: 0px;background-color: rgba(6,51,107,0.7); font-weight: bold; padding-top:15%; cursor: pointer; display: none; transition: all 0.6s;}
.hzhb_wh:hover h1,.xkh_tjcp:hover .zzc_a{display:block;animation: hideIndex 0.3s;  -moz-animation: hideIndex  0.3s; -webkit-animation: hideIndex  0.3s;  -o-animation: hideIndex  0.3s;}
.hzhb_wh img{width:100%;}
.db_ff{background:#32373a;}
.wh_flogo img{width:100%;}
.f_dha dd a:link,.f_dha dd a:visited{color:#f1f1f1;}
.das_fend{margin-top:30px; padding-top: 15px; border-top:1px solid #393939;  padding-bottom: 15px;color:#fff; text-align: center;}
.n_bb{position:relative;}



.m_shubiao { position:relative; width: 22px; height: 40px;float: left; z-index: 999;}
.m_shubiao img {  width: 100%;}
.m_shubiao p:nth-child(1) { width: 22px;  height: 40px;  background: url(../images/m_ban1.png)no-repeat center bottom;
    position: absolute; left: 0; bottom: 0; animation: mysecond 2s infinite normal; z-index: 99;}
.m_shubiao p:nth-child(2) { width: 22px; height: 0px; background: url(../images/m_ban1_1.png)no-repeat center top;
    position: absolute; left: 0; top: 0; animation: myfirst 2s infinite normal; z-index: 91;}
.wh_dqwz{width:100%; float: left; background: #f1f1f1;  }
.wh_dqwza a:link,.wh_dqwza a:visited{color:#222;}
.ny_qywh{background:#f1f1f1;}
.unti_lb{text-align:center;}
.unti_lb .link_unti{background:#164a92;}
.unti_lb .link_unti:link,.unti_lb .link_unti:visited{color:#fff;}
.unti_lb a{ background: #fafafa; }
.unti_lb a:link,.unti_lb a:visited{color:#222;}
.unti_lb a:hover{background: #06349a;border: 2px solid #06349a;color:#fff;}
.conttent_tx{background:#f1f1f1;}
.wh_casea,.wh_casea img{transition:all 0.6s;}
.wh_casea h1{border-left:1px solid #f1f1f1;border-right:1px solid #f1f1f1;border-bottom:1px solid #f1f1f1;}
.wh_casea h1 span{float:right; transition:all 0.6s;}
.wh_casea a:link,.wh_casea a:visited{color:#222;}
.wh_casea img{}
.wh_casea:hover span{padding-right:15px;color:#06349a;}
.wh_casea:hover{box-shadow: -2px 0px 3px 1px rgba(0, 0, 0, 0.12);}
.wh_casea1{overflow:hidden;}
.wh_casea:hover img{transform: scale(1.2);}
.wh_video{position:relative;}
.zcc{width:100%; height: 100%; position: absolute; top:0px; background: url(../images/dot_black.png);}
	.v_tt{position:absolute; width: 100%; color:#fff; padding: 0px 5%;}
.fkm_head{  z-index: 888; background: url(../images/head_bg.jpg) center;}
.cp_syss{background:#fff; padding: 3%; border-radius: 8px;}
.fkm_headdh{background:#3d4148;}
.xkh_syab,.xkh_title{position:relative;}
.mor_a,.xkh_tjcp{text-align:center;}
.cp_syssb input{width:100%; border: 1px solid #eee; font-family: 'Poppins'; transition: all 0.6s;}
.cp_syssc button{width:100%; border: 0px; background: #222;color:#fff;font-family: 'Poppins-SemiBold';}
.mor_a a,.tjcp .mor_a a{border-top:1px solid #fff; font-family: 'Poppins'; padding-top: 10px; transition: all 0.6s;}
.mor_a a:link,.mor_a a:visited{color:#fff;}
.mor_a a:hover{color:#c30404;border-top:1px solid #c30404;}
.tjcp .mor_a a{border-top:1px solid #222;}
.tjcp .mor_a a:link,.tjcp .mor_a a:visited{color:#222;}
.cp_syssb input:hover{box-shadow:0px 2px 7px rgba(195,4,4,0.5);}
.zzc_a{position:absolute; display: none;transition:all 0.6s; top: 0px;width: 100%; height: 100%; background: rgba(0,0,0,0.8); padding: 20%;color:#fff;}
.zzc_a dd{width:60%; float: left; ont-family: 'Poppins'; font-size:18px; position: absolute; bottom:10%;}
.skh_tjnews img{width:100%;}
.skh_xpemail input{width:76%; border-bottom:2px solid #fff; border-top:0px solid #fff;border-left:0px solid #fff; border-right:0px solid #fff;  background: none; float: left; padding: 15px 0px;}
.skh_xpemail button{width:22%; float: right;font-family: 'Poppins-SemiBold'; font-size:20px; background:#036eb8; color:#fff; border: 0px;}
#zxly_menu{display:none;}
#zxp{width:100%; float: left; background: #fff;}
.fkm_headdh li .lm_ycdhb a:link,.fkm_headdh li .lm_ycdhb a:visited{color:#222;}
#zxly_menua{display:none; background: #fff; width: 100%; float: left;}

.zxly_menud button{width:100%; border: 0px; background: #111;color:#fff;}
.zxly_menub textarea{width:100%;border: 1px solid #333; padding: 10px 15px;}
.cp_imgxp img{width:100%;}
.cp_xqac button{border:0px; color:#fff; font-family: 'Poppins';}
.cpxq_menu .layui-tab-title .layui-this{background:#036eb8;}
.cp_xqac p,.cpxq_menu{width:100%; float: left;}
.xkh_nyss input:hover,.xkh_nyss select:hover{box-shadow:0px 2px 7px rgba(195,4,4,0.5);}
.tjss button:hover{background:#c30404;}
.cp_xqac .xp:link,.cp_xqac .xp:visited{color:#fff;}
.tjss button{border: 0px;font-family: 'Poppins-SemiBold';color:#fff;}
.xkh_nyss{background:#f1f1f1;}
.xkh_cprighta font{margin:0px 10px;}
.xkh_cprighta{border-bottom:1px solid #333;}
.xkh_cplistb .k_1,.cs_main .k_1{background:#111;color:#fff;}
.xkh_cplistb .k_2,.cs_main .k_2{border:1px solid #111;}
.xkh_cplista{overflow:hidden;}
.xkh_cplefta3 a:link,.xkh_cplefta3 a:visited,.xkh_cpleft a:link,.xkh_cpleft a:visited{color:#222;}
.xkh_cplefta3 dd:hover{padding:10px 25px;}
.xkh_cplist img{width:100%;}
.xkh_cplefta3 dd:hover a{color:#c30404;}
.lm_ycdhb dd{font-size:20px;font-family: 'Poppins';text-transform: capitalize;}
.lm_ycdhb dd a:link,.lm_ycdhb dd a:visited{color:#222;}
.lm_ycdhb dd:hover{ padding-left: 10px;}
.fkm_headdh li .lm_ycdhb dd:hover a{color:#c30404;}
.fkm_headdh li:hover{}
.skh_tjnews a:link,.skh_tjnews a:visited{color:#222;}
.h_tt{font-size:30px;font-family: 'Roboto'; font-weight: bold; text-transform: uppercase; padding-bottom: 15px;}
.top_searchvv input{width:100%; float: left; background: #fff;color:#222; border: 0px; padding: 20px 15px;}
.top_searchvv button{width:120px; margin-top: 30px; border: 0px; background:#222; height: 40px;}
.search_bg button{border:0px; background: none;color:#111; text-transform: uppercase;}
.skh_tjnews{font-family: 'Poppins'; }
.pc_but{border:0px; background: none;}
.das_fenda li{width:50%; float: left;}
.skh_tjnews:hover .skh_tjnewsb,.skh_tjnews:hover h1{color:#c30404; padding-left: 10px;}
.skh_tjnews:hover  dd{transform: rotate(-2deg);-o-transform: rotate(-2deg);-webkit-transform: rotate(-2deg);-moz-transform: rotate(-2deg);}
.f_dhb dd span{margin-right:10px;color:#036eb8;}
.skh_fx a:link,.skh_fx a:visited{color:#8e8e8e;}
.lm_ycdhb p{width:60px; height: 3px; background:#c30404; margin-bottom: 20px;}
.n_btt dd a:link,.n_btt dd a:visited{color:#fff;}
.n_btt dd{color:#fff;}
.xkh_cplefta3 .dd_link a{font-weight: bold;color:#c30404;}
.dd_link a:link,.dd_link a:visited{color:#fff;font-weight: bold;}
.dd_link{background:#036eb8;}
.fkm_headdh .link_hover:link,.fkm_headdh .link_hover:visited{color:#036eb8;}
.wh_title h1{color:#036eb8}
.ff_video{background:#036eb8;}

@keyframes mysecond {
    0% { height: 100%; }
    10% {height: 90%;}
    20% {height: 80%;}
    30% {height: 70%;}
    40% {height: 60%;}
    50% {height: 50%;}
    60% {height: 40%;}
    70% {height: 30%;}
    80% {height: 20%;}
    90% {height: 10%;}
    100% {height: 0%;}
}
